How much does a Teller make in Bakersfield, CA?

The average salary for a Teller is $43,786 per year in Bakersfield, CA.

In Bakersfield, CA, a Teller can expect to earn an average yearly salary of around $43,786. This position offers a range of salaries depending on experience and skills. Entry-level Tellers often start at about $34,000 per year. With time and experience, salaries can increase significantly.


As Tellers gain more expertise, they can earn up to $52,900 annually. The salary distribution shows that many Tellers in the region earn between $37,255 and $47,018 per year, which reflects a stable earning potential. What are the best paying companies for Teller in Bakersfield, CA?

In Bakersfield, CA, the best paying companies for Teller jobs include Bank of the Sierra, which offers an average salary of $51,900. Wells Fargo follows with an average salary of $45,650. Other notable employers include Tri Counties Bank, Mission Bank, and AppleOne, providing competitive pay rates as well.
